Manuel Pangilinan-led infrastructure conglomerate Metro Pacific Investments Corp. is taking another bite in the agriculture segment, months after buying the Carmen's Best ice cream and dairy group from the Magsaysay family. Pangilinan said they signed an initial agreement for an unnamed agriculture investment, which they hope to conclude in a few months. Commenting on the deal size, Pangilinan said it was "not small." The businessman is deploying more investments in agriculture following the P200-million acquisition of Carmen's Best, an integrated dairy business.
